Which document provides a summary of a patient's medical history?

Explanation:
The document that provides a summary of a patient's medical history is the Problem List. This list is crucial in clinical practice as it offers a concise view of a patient's current and past health issues, including diagnosed conditions, unresolved problems, and any relevant medical history that may affect current treatment. It serves as a quick reference for healthcare providers, helping them to easily identify the key medical issues of a patient at a glance. In contrast, while the SOAP note is a structured format for documenting patient encounters, it focuses on subjective and objective findings, assessment, and plan rather than summarizing the entire medical history. The Assessment report provides an evaluation of a patient's condition but does not encapsulate the full history like a Problem List. Progress notes track patient treatment and responses over time, rather than consolidating past medical history into a summary. Hence, the Problem List is the most appropriate document for summarizing a patient's medical history.
